U.S. Supreme Court Allows Muslim Men to Sue Over ‘No-Fly' List Placement

The U.S. Supreme Court on Thursday let three American Muslim men sue several FBI agents who they accused of placing them on the government's "no-fly list" for refusing to become informants, rejecting a challenge to the lawsuit by President Donald Trump's administration.
